Dolphin does not include the ''Wii Menu'' by default, and it doesn't need it; it is able to launch games straight from the Dolphin GUI. However, the menu is fully functional; it can load channels and even discs. == Installation guide == | |||
1) Use NUSD to download the latest System Menu as a WAD file. | |||
2) Follow the Network Certificates section on the page you're looking at. | |||
3) In Dolphin click Tools > Install WAD and choose the System Menu WAD. | |||
4) Tools > Perform Online System Update | |||
5) Tools > Load Wii System Menu | |||
